Common Myths and Misconceptions About Magic Mushrooms

0
Please log in or register to do it.

Magic mushrooms have become one of the talked-about natural psychedelics in recent years. As public interest grows, so does confusion. Some folks describe magic mushrooms as a breakthrough for mental health, while others see them only as dangerous illegal drugs. The reality is more complex. Magic mushrooms contain psilocybin, a psychedelic compound that may strongly affect mood, notion, thoughts, and the sense of time. Because of these powerful effects, it is important to separate common myths from facts.

Fantasy 1: Magic Mushrooms Are Fully Harmless Because They Are Natural

One of the biggest misconceptions about magic mushrooms is that they have to be safe merely because they develop naturally. Many natural substances can have robust effects on the body and mind, and psilocybin is no exception. Magic mushrooms can cause nausea, vomiting, dizziness, muscle weakness, confusion, panic reactions, and impaired coordination. Some individuals can also expertise horrifying hallucinations or intense nervousness, particularly in unsafe settings or when they are emotionally unprepared.

“Natural” doesn’t automatically imply risk-free. The effects of magic mushrooms can range widely from individual to individual, and factors equivalent to mental health history, environment, expectations, and different substances can affect the experience.

Fable 2: Everybody Has a Positive Expertise

Another common fantasy is that magic mushrooms always create a peaceful, spiritual, or joyful experience. While some people report significant or positive experiences, others might have uncomfortable or distressing reactions. Psilocybin can change perception, emotions, and thinking patterns, which means an individual might feel inspired and calm, however they might also feel concern, confusion, paranoia, or emotional overwhelm.

This is one reason researchers study psilocybin in controlled clinical environments reasonably than informal or unpredictable settings. A supportive environment, careful screening, and professional supervision are important parts of medical research involving psychedelics.

Fable three: Magic Mushrooms Are the Same as a Mental Health Treatment

Psilocybin is being studied for possible therapeutic use, especially in relation to depression and other severe mental health conditions. However, this doesn’t mean magic mushrooms themselves are an approved or simple treatment. Clinical research usually includes controlled doses, trained professionals, screening for risks, and structured psychological support.

Using magic mushrooms outside a clinical setting could be very different from participating in regulated therapy or medical research. People mustn’t assume that taking mushrooms on their own will treat depression, anxiety, trauma, or addiction. Mental health conditions require proper medical advice and proof-based care.

Fantasy 4: Magic Mushrooms Are Legal In all places Now

Because psychedelic research and public discussion have elevated, many people imagine magic mushrooms are now broadly legal. This is just not true. Laws vary by country, region, and city. Within the United States, psilocybin remains a Schedule I substance under federal law, that means possession, manufacturing, or distribution can carry serious legal consequences.

Some places have changed enforcement priorities or created limited legal frameworks, but that doesn’t imply magic mushrooms are legal everywhere. Anyone interested in this topic should understand the laws in their specific location.

Fable 5: Magic Mushrooms Are Not Addictive, So There Are No Risks

Psilocybin is often described as having lower addiction potential than many other substances, however that does not imply there are not any risks. A substance could be non-addictive and still cause psychological distress, poor judgment, risky behavior, or negative interactions with present mental health conditions. In the course of the effects of psilocybin, people may be less aware of danger, less coordinated, and less able to make clear decisions.

The risk will not be only about addiction. It is also about safety, environment, mental state, and personal vulnerability.

Fantasy 6: All Mushrooms Are the Same

Not all mushrooms are magic mushrooms, and not all magic mushrooms have the same strength. Completely different species can contain different amounts of psilocybin. There may be additionally the intense risk of complicated mushrooms with poisonous species. Misidentification can lead to dangerous poisoning. This is among the most overlooked risks in casual discussions about mushrooms.

Delusion 7: A Bad Expertise Means Everlasting Damage

Some folks fear that one troublesome psychedelic experience always causes everlasting psychological harm. That can be an exaggeration. Many unpleasant experiences pass once the substance wears off. However, some people could really feel shaken afterward, and individuals with sure mental health vulnerabilities may be at higher risk of longer-lasting distress. The safest approach is to treat psilocybin as a strong substance, not as a hurtless trend.

Final Ideas

Magic mushrooms are surrounded by myths on both sides. They are not merely a miracle cure, but they are also not just a topic of fear. Psilocybin is a powerful psychedelic compound with real effects, real risks, and critical research interest. Understanding the details helps people have more informed conversations about magic mushrooms, mental health, legality, and safety.

As interest in psychedelics continues to develop, an important thing is balanced information. Magic mushrooms shouldn’t be romanticized, minimized, or misunderstood. They need to be mentioned responsibly, with attention to science, law, mental health, and personal safety.
